The Crucial Budget for Affordable Housing

As India steps into the budgetary discussions for 2026, the focus on affordable housing has never been more critical. Urban housing affordability is a growing concern, putting pressure on millions looking to secure their own homes.

Understanding the Current Landscape

The urban real estate market is evolving, yet the challenges of affordability persist. In many urban centers, escalating prices have outpaced income growth, making it increasingly difficult for average citizens to purchase homes.

Key Wish List for Budget 2026

  • Increased allocation for affordable housing projects.
  • Enhanced credit subsidies to ease home loans.
  • Tax breaks for first-time homebuyers.
  • Streamlined approval processes for developers.
  • Initiatives for sustainable and green housing.

In conclusion, the upcoming budget presents an opportunity to address these pressing concerns and foster a more equitable housing market.
